Electrical Panel Upgrading in Utah County, UT
Electrical panel upgrading services involve replacing or enhancing the main electrical distribution point in a home to support increased power needs or improve safety. This service is commonly requested during home renovations, the addition of new appliances, or when existing panels are outdated and unable to handle modern electrical demands. Property owners should understand the importance of a properly sized and functioning electrical panel to ensure reliable power distribution and to prevent potential electrical issues. Before requesting an upgrade, it’s helpful to consider the current electrical load, the age of the existing panel, and any future plans that may require additional circuits or capacity.
Projects covered by electrical panel upgrading typically include replacing an old or faulty panel, increasing circuit capacity, or installing new safety features such as surge protection or grounding upgrades. Homeowners often want to know whether their current panel can meet their household's power needs and what improvements can enhance safety and efficiency. It is advisable to evaluate the size and condition of the existing panel and to discuss any future electrical requirements with a professional to determine the most suitable upgrade options. Properly upgraded panels can support a safer and more reliable electrical system tailored to the specific needs of the property.

Electrical Panel Upgrading Questions
Why is upgrading an electrical panel important? Upgrading enhances safety, supports increased electrical demands, and reduces the risk of electrical issues in the property.
What types of projects typically require a panel upgrade? Common projects include adding new appliances, finishing basements, or updating outdated electrical systems for better performance.
How can I tell if my electrical panel needs an upgrade? Signs include frequent circuit breaker trips, flickering lights, or an aging panel that no longer meets the property's electrical needs.
What should property owners consider before upgrading their electrical panel? It's important to assess current electrical loads, future needs, and ensure proper compatibility with existing wiring and systems.
